How we predictBoth teams are in UEFA Conference League qualifying, with everything to play for. Liepaja have already eliminated FK Dečić Tuzi in the previous round, showing they can grind out results. Austria Wien enter the competition aiming to progress, but with a tougher schedule ahead in the Austrian Bundesliga, this match is a priority. Motivation is high on both sides, but the pressure is on Austria Wien as the higher-profile club. Liepaja will see this as a chance to cause an upset and make a name for themselves. The minor league difference adds to their desire to prove themselves.
Liepaja have won both their matches this season, both against Dečić Tuzi. The home leg ended 1-0 in a match that saw a red card to the opponent, skewing the data. The away leg was a 2-1 win, but no xG data is available. These results suggest defensive solidity but limited sample. Austria Wien have no form data from the current season, but their marker matches from last year show a high-scoring, attacking side. They beat FC Spaeri 5-0 away and lost 4-3 to Baník Ostrava. These matches averaged 6 goals, indicating a side that both scores and concedes freely. Their style is gung-ho, which often leads to open games.
Both teams have full squads available with no injuries or suspensions. This is a rare luxury for both coaches. Liepaja's coach Vladimir Vassiljev has 10 key players at his disposal, same as Austria Wien's Stephan Helm with 9 key players. Rotation is possible given the early season, but with so much at stake, both are likely to field their strongest XIs. The absence of any unavailable players means tactical plans are unaffected, though depth could be tested if the match goes into extra time.
Without formation data, we rely on markers. Austria Wien average 55% possession away, with 18.67 shots and 7.67 shots on target per match. They create 5 big chances per away game, suggesting a dominant attacking style. However, they also concede 2 big chances and 4.67 shots on target, showing defensive vulnerabilities. Liepaja's only marker saw them defend after an early red card, so little attacking data. Expect Austria Wien to dominate possession and create chances, but Liepaja may sit deep and hit on the counter. Given Austria Wien's leaky defense, Liepaja could find opportunities. This clash of styles screams goals.
HOME markers for FK Liepaja (sample: 1 match): vs FK Dečić Tuzi (H) 1-0 [RED min 21]. This match is heavily distorted by the early red card, making it unreliable for pattern detection. Liepaja scored early and then sat back. No xG or corners data. AWAY markers for FK Austria Wien (sample: 2 matches): vs Baník Ostrava (A) 3-4 (BC 5-3, shots 19-19, SoT 7-7, corners 9-4, poss 58%, 1H 1-2). This was a chaotic end-to-end game with 7 goals. Austria Wien led 1-0, then trailed 2-1 at half time, eventually losing 4-3. They created 5 big chances but conceded 3. vs FC Spaeri (A) 5-0 (BC 5-0, shots 18-3, SoT 9-0, corners 4-1, poss 49%, pen 1-0, 1H corners 2-1). A dominant performance against a weak side, with a penalty. They kept a clean sheet but that was against minimal attacking threat. Tactical pattern: Austria Wien are high-volume shot takers, averaging 18.67 shots and 7.67 SoT away. They also commit fouls (14 avg) and draw many free kicks (6 attacked, 14 conceded). Their corners average 7.33 for, 3.00 against. They tend to concede in most matches but can blow away weak opposition. The sample is small but consistent in attacking intent.
No meetings found between these teams in the last 12 months. This is a first-ever competitive encounter. With no historical data to draw from, the match will be determined by current form and tactics. The lack of H2H adds uncertainty, but also reduces bias.
